Despite having a horrific game Starkel did tie up the game for us in the 4th quarter... only for our defense to completely collapse.
Yes, he threw his 5th INT after that but 2 or 3 of his INTs were panicked "I've got to get it all in this one throw!" A good OC and coaching staff either settles down the QB when he's doing that or realizes that it just isn't his night and pulls him.
Starkel was hideous out there. But our running game was the drizzling poo. Our defense was a sin in the eyes of God. And our coaching decisions...
Twice we went for it on 4th down with runs up the middle, something we failed at all game long, even though we were in easy field goal range. We kick those two FGs and maybe Starkel isn't as panicky on the final drive because all he has to do is get us in FG range.
